Get started439 Otley Road is a three-bedroom semi-detached house in Leeds (LS16 6AJ). It has a recorded floor area of 237 m² (around 2551 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band E. The latest certificate (October 2024) shows a D (score 68),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in April 2010 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Average to Good; while roof efficiency dropped from Average to Poor.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 81), a 2-band jump.
At 237 m² the property is well over the postcode median (129 m² across 6 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. Today's modelled estimate of £600,000 sits 112.8% above the 2012 sale of £282,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£111/sq ft) was about 47.6% below the postcode norm.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2012.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. On the market in March 2012 and unlisted since — roughly 14 years.
